McDonalds virtual trainer

mcmaya.png

I am always amused by the effort that fast food restaurants put forth in trying to escape the “stereotype” of being unhealthy. Especially after the movie Supersize Me came out, it seems a lot of them have been regularly trying to revamp their image with some health related campaign or another.

This time around McDonalds is giving away (until supply lasts) a 15-minute workout video if you order a salad. You can choose between Core, Strength, Cardio and Yoga. Insert the DVD into your player and Maya, McDonalds’ personal virtual instructor, will magically help you work out the quarter pounder with cheese that you ordered along with your salad, because let’s face it, I've never been able to enter a McDonalds and just get salad.

That said, I think I would like the yoga DVD.
